S6-GR1P(1-3)K-M series inverter is designed for residential PV plants. The maximum input current per string is 14A, which is compatible with high-efficiency modules and bi-facial modules. Compact and lightweight design, make it easy to install. Fanless design, lower noise, brings you a comfortable living environment. Integrated AFCI function can proactively reduce the risk of fire.

| Models | 1K | 2K | 3K |
|---|---|---|---|
| Input DC | |||
| Recommended max. PV power | 1.5 kW | 3 kW | 4.5 kW |
| Max. input voltage | 550 V | ||
| Rated voltage | 200 V | 330 V | |
| Start-up voltage | 50 V | 80 V | |
| MPPT voltage range | 40–500 V | 70–500 V | |
| Max. input current | 16 A | ||
| Max. short circuit current | 22 A | ||
| MPPT number / Max. input strings number | 1 / 1 | ||
| Output AC | |||
| Rated output power | 1 kW | 2 kW | 3 kW |
| Max. apparent output power | 1.1 kVA | 2.2 kVA | 3.3 kVA |
| Max. output power | 1.1 kW | 2.2 kW | 3.3 kW |
| Rated grid voltage | 1/N/PE, 220 / 230 V | ||
| Rated grid frequency | 50 Hz | ||
| Rated grid output current | 4.5 A / 4.3 A | 9.1 A / 8.7 A | 13.6 A / 13 A |
| Max. output current | 5.0 A | 10.0 A | 15.0 A |
| Power factor | >0.99 (0.8 leading – 0.8 lagging) | ||
| THDi | <3% | ||
| DC injection current | <0.5% In | ||
| Efficiency | |||
| Max. efficiency | 96.6% | 97.1% | 97.1% |
| EU efficiency | 95.3% | 96.4% | 96.4% |
| Protection | |||
| DC reverse-polarity protection | Yes | ||
| Short circuit protection | Yes | ||
| Insulation resistance monitoring | Yes | ||
| Residual current detection | Yes | ||
| Output over current protection | Yes | ||
| Surge protection | T3 (DC), T2 (AC) | ||
| Grid monitoring | Yes | ||
| Anti-islanding protection | Yes | ||
| Temperature protection | Yes | ||
| Integrated AFCI (DC arc-fault circuit protection) | Yes* | ||
| Integrated DC switch | No | ||
| General Data | |||
| Dimensions (W×H×D) | 310×373×160 mm | ||
| Weight | 7.1 kg | 7.4 kg | |
| Topology | Transformerless | ||
| Self-consumption (night) | <1 W | ||
| Operating ambient temperature range | -25 ~ +60°C | ||
| Relative humidity | 0–100% | ||
| Ingress protection | IP66 | ||
| Noise emission (typical) | <20 dB(A) | ||
| Cooling concept | Natural convection | ||
| Max. operation altitude | 4000 m | ||
| Grid connection standard | IEC 61683, IEC 60068, IEC 61727, IEC 62116, EN 50530, IS 16169 / IS 16221(BIS) | ||
| Safety / EMC standard | IEC 62109-1/-2, IEC 61000-6-1/-2/-3/-4 | ||
| Features | |||
| DC connection | MC4 connector | ||
| AC connection | Quick connection plug | ||
| Display | LCD | ||
| Communication | RS485, Optional: ENP-WIFI-5S, ENP-GPRS-5S | ||

Types of Solar Inverter for Home
On-Grid Solar Inverter
An on-grid solar inverter for home is an inverter that can work with the main electricity grid. It can use solar power during the day and can also send unused electricity back to the grid. This is an excellent option for those who want to save on electricity costs but do not need any backup power.
How to Choose the Best Inverter for Solar Panel
To choose the best inverter for solar panel, you need to consider your home's energy needs. First, you need to choose an inverter with an adequate capacity, such as 3kW. For instance, if you are looking for the best 3kW solar inverter in India, it is an excellent option for small to medium homes.
Another factor is efficiency. A high-efficiency solar inverter for home will provide better performance and savings. Also, ensure the inverter is battery ready, depending on your requirements.
Another factor is the warranty and support from the company. Always opt for a reliable company. A reliable solar inverter for home must be long-lasting, simple, and require less maintenance.
